이동 애드혹 네트워크에서 이웃노드 정보를 이용한 AODV 라우팅 프로토콜의 설계 및 평가

Design and Evaluation of Neighbor-aware AODV Routing Protocol in Mobile Ad-hoc Network

  • 김철중 (경원대학교 전자계산학과) ;
  • 박석천 (경원대학교 소프트웨어학부)
  • 발행 : 2008.06.30


이동성을 가진 다수의 노드들로 구성된 MANET에서는 네트워크 토폴로지의 빈번한 변화에 효과적으로 대응할 수 있는 온디맨드 방식의 라우팅 프로토콜이 주로 사용된다. 기존의 AODV 라우팅 기법에서 목적지 노드가 local repair 지역을 벗어나서 이동하고 있을 때, local repair 방법은 불필요한 시간지연을 가져다 줄 뿐이며, 이러한 local repair 방법으로 인한 시간지연은 전체적인 라우팅 경로의 설정시간을 오래 걸리게 할 뿐 아니라, 생성된 데이터 패킷의 손실을 증가시키는 문제를 가져온다. 따라서 본 논문에서는 목적지 노드까지의 경로 단절시 출발지 노드로 가서 경로 재탐색을 하지 않고 이웃 노드의 순서번호를 이용하여 직접 경로설정을 위한 동작을 할 경우 보다 신속하게 경로를 설정할 수 있으며, 데이터의 패킷 손실도 줄여 줄 수 있는 AODV 기반 효율적인 라우팅 프로토콜인 NAODV 프로토콜을 제안하였다. NS-2를 이용한 시뮬레이션 결과는 제안한 기법이 기존의 AODV 보다 패킷 전달비율, 지연시간 측면에서 향상된 성능을 제공함을 보여준다. 또한 노드의 이동 속도가 빠르고 대형망으로 갈수록 더욱 효과적인 방법임을 확인하였다.

A MANET is an autonomous, infrastructureless system that consists of mobile nodes. In MANET, on-demand routing protocols are usually used because network topology changes frequently. The current approach in case of broken routes is to flag an error and re-initiate route discovery either at the source or at the intermediate node. Repairing these broken links is a costly affair in terms of routing overhead and delay involved. Therefore, this paper propose a NAODV(Neighbor-aware AODV) protocol that stands on the basis of an AODV. It sets up the route rapidly if it operates for setting the route directly by using sequence number of neighbor nodes without re-search the route when the route to destination node is broken. Also, it reduces loss of packets. We use NS-2 for the computer simulation and validate that the proposed scheme is better than general AODV in terms of packet delivery ratio and average end-to-end delay. Also, when the proposed protocol is applied to the large ad-hoc network with multiple nodes, the performance is more efficient.



  1. E. M. Royer and C. K. Toh, “A review of current routing protocols for adhoc mobile wireless networks,” IEEE Personal Communications, pp.46-55, April 1998
  2. C. K. Toh, “Ad hoc mobile wireless networks protocols and systems,” Prentice Hall PTR, pp.13-25, 2002
  3. M. S. Corson and J. P. Macker, “Mobile ad-hoc networking(Manet) : routing protocol performance issues and evaluation considerations,” IETF RFC 2501, January 1999
  4. IEEE MANET Working Group,
  5. 김중태, 모상만, 정일웅, “모바일 애드혹 네트워크에서의 AODV 기반 최대 비중첩 다중경로라우팅 프로토콜,” 한국정보처리학회논문지, 제21-C권 제3호, pp. 429-436, 2005
  6. M. K. Marina and S. R. Das, “Ad Hoc On-demand Multipath Distance Vector Routing,” http://www.ececs.uc.-edu/~sdas, Technical Report, Computer Science Department, Stony Brook University, Apr, 2003
  7. D. B. Johnson and D. A. Maltz, “Dynamic Source Routing in Ad Hoc Wireless Networks,” in Mobile computing, T. Imielinski and H. Korth, Eds. Kluwer Academic Publishers, pp. 153-181, 1996
  8. Genping Liu, Kai-Juan Wong, Bu-Sung Lee, Boon-Chong Seet, Chuan-Heng Foh, Lijuan Zhu, “PATCH: A Novel Local Recovery Mechanism for Mobile Ad-hoc Networks,” IEEE vehicular technology conference, pp. 2995-2999, 2003
  9. C. E. Perkins, E. M. Belding-Royer and S. R. Das, “Adhoc on-demand distance vector (AODV) routing,” IETF RFC 3561, July 2003
  10. M. S. Corson and A. Ephremides, “A distributed routing algorithm for mobile wireless networks,” Wireless Networks 1, 1995
  11. E. Gafni and D. Bertsekas, “Distributed algorithms for generating loop-free routes in networks with frequently changing topology,” IEEE Trans. Commun, January 1981
  12. M. S. Corson, and A. Rphremides, “A distributed routing algorithm for mobile wireless networks,” ACM/ Baltzer journal on Wireless Networks, January 1995
  13. Z. J. Haas, “A new routing protocol for the reconfigurable wireless networks,” ICUPC'97, San Diego, CA, Oct. 12, 1997
  14. “The Network Simulator, ns-2,”